15 Möglichkeiten zur Optimierung und Beschleunigung von WordPress-Sites
Veröffentlicht: 2021-04-29
WordPress ist eine großartige Plattform zum Erstellen einer Website für Ihr Unternehmen. Ein Mangel, den es auf jeden Fall hat, ist, dass es sehr moderat sein kann.
Ohne auf Nummer sicher zu gehen, könnten Sie auf einer faulen Seite landen.
Das ist lästig für Rehash-Gäste und führt dazu, dass Sie Unterstützer und Kunden verlieren.
In diesem kurzen Beitrag werde ich die meisten idealen Möglichkeiten behandeln, die ich gefunden habe, um WordPress zuverlässig zu beschleunigen.
Wie kann man WordPress beschleunigen?
Wähle einen guten Gastgeber
Zu Beginn kann ein gemeinsamer Gastgeber wie ein Deal erscheinen („Unbegrenzte Seitenaufrufe!“). Es hat einen weiteren Preis: eine erstaunlich moderate Website-Geschwindigkeit und häufige Ausfallzeiten während hoher Bewegungszeiten.
Für den Fall, dass Sie voraussichtlich wichtige Inhalte verteilen, führen Sie Ihre WordPress-Site auf Shared Hosting aus.
Die Sorge, dass Ihre Site nach dem Erhalt einer Hauptkomponente untergeht, reicht aus, um ein paar frühe Silberhaare zu machen: Seien Sie kein Opfer, stecken Sie Ressourcen in geeignetes Hosting.
Das wichtigste WordPress, das ich unaufhörlich vorschlage, ist…
Von WP Engine verwaltetes WordPress-Hosting
Meine Ziele sind zuverlässig blitzschnell, haben keine Ausfallzeiten, wenn ich riesige Elemente bekomme (wie als ich im Discovery Channel-Blog hervorgehoben wurde!), und das Back-End ist alles andere als schwer zu bedienen.
Zusammenfassend lässt sich sagen, dass Stärkung die Wahl ist, was in Bezug auf das Hosting eine absolute Notwendigkeit ist. Nehmen Sie es von jemandem, der das auf den schwierigsten Weg herausgefunden hat.
Gehen Sie zur WP Engine-Landingpage und sehen Sie sich die Angebote an. Sie werden froh sein, dass Sie es getan haben.
Beginnen Sie mit einem soliden Thema/Framework
Sie werden hier vielleicht erstaunt sein, aber das Twenty Fifteen „System“ (auch bekannt als das Standard-WP-Thema) ist leichtgewichtig und sehr schnell.
Das liegt daran, dass sie die „Mut“ grundlegend halten; Vergleichen Sie das mit aufgeblähten Systemen, die riesige Mengen an Komponenten haben, die Sie nie verwenden werden, was Ihre Site zu einem Kriechen macht.
Aus meiner Erfahrung ist sicherlich das Thesis Theme Framework die schnellste Stacking-Premiumstruktur. Es übertrifft die wesentlichen WordPress-Themes, indem es weit weniger anspruchsvoll zu ändern ist.
Es ist ein unergründlich starkes System, das Sie nicht mit zahlreichen Plugins oder benutzerdefinierten Änderungen zurückhält. Bringen Sie die zum Thema passenden Verbesserungen ein und vermeiden Sie Blähungen, hurra!
Verwenden Sie ein effektives Caching-Plugin
WordPress-Plugins sind eindeutig sehr wertvoll, aber ein Teil der besten fällt in die Reservierungsklasse, da sie die Ladezeit der Seite radikal verbessern und das Beste daran ist, dass jedes von ihnen auf WP.org kostenlos und einfach zu verwenden ist.
Mit Abstand mein Top-Pick ist ausnahmslos W3 Total Cache, ich würde kein anderes Speichermodul vorschreiben oder verwenden, es enthält den größten Teil der von Ihnen benötigten Komponenten und ist in hohem Maße einfach einzuführen und zu verwenden.
Verwenden Sie ein Content Delivery Network (CDN)
Der größte Teil Ihrer beliebtesten riesigen Websites nutzt dies, und wenn Sie sich für Internet-Präsentationen mit WordPress interessieren (wie ich sicher bin, dass große Teile meiner Leser zu sein scheinen), werden Sie nicht schockiert sein hier, dass einige Ihrer beliebtesten Web-Journals wie Copyblogger CDNs verwenden.
Im Grunde genommen nimmt ein CDN oder ein Stofftransportarrangement alle Ihre statischen Aufzeichnungen, die Sie auf Ihrer Website haben (CSS, Javascript und Bilder usw.), und gibt Gästen die Möglichkeit, sie so schnell wie möglich herunterzuladen, indem die Dokumente auf Servern so nah wie möglich bereitgestellt werden sie, wie es unter den gegebenen Umständen zu erwarten war.
Bilder optimieren (automatisch)
Hurra! hat einen Bildoptimierer namens Smush.it, der die Aufnahmegröße eines Bildes radikal verringert, ohne die Qualität zu beeinträchtigen.
Jedenfalls, falls Sie mir ähnlich sind, wäre es eine Qual, dies mit jedem Bild zu tun, und außerordentlich mühsam.
Glücklicherweise gibt es ein erstaunliches, kostenloses Modul namens WP-SmushIt, das diesen Vorgang für den größten Teil Ihrer Bilder auf natürliche Weise übernimmt, während Sie sie übertragen. Kein Grund, diesen nicht vorzustellen.
Optimieren Sie Ihre Homepage, um schnell zu laden
Dies ist kein gewisses Etwas, aber wirklich ein paar einfache Dinge, die Sie tun können, um sicherzustellen, dass Ihre Zielseite schnell gestapelt wird, was wahrscheinlich der wichtigste Teil Ihrer Website ist, da Personen dort häufig ankommen.
Dinge, die Sie tun können, umfassen:
- Auswahlen statt vollständige Beiträge anzeigen
- Reduzieren Sie die Anzahl der Beiträge auf der Seite (ich erscheine gerne zwischen 5-7)
- Verbannen Sie sinnlose Sharing-Gadgets von der Zielseite (integrieren Sie sie nur in Beiträge)
- Entferne ruhende Plugins und Gadgets, mit denen du dich nicht beschäftigen musst
- Halten Sie in vernachlässigbar! Leser sind für Inhalte da, nicht für 8.000 Gadgets auf der Zielseite
Optimieren Sie Ihre WordPress-Datenbank
Ich ziehe in diesem Beitrag sicherlich ein erhebliches Maß an Nutzung durch „optimieren“!
Möglich soll dies die extrem repetitive, extrem anstrengende manuelle Form, oder…
Sie können im Wesentlichen das WP-Optimize-Modul verwenden, das ich auf den meisten meiner Gebietsschemas verwende.
Dieses Modul gibt Ihnen die Möglichkeit, nur ein grundlegendes Unterfangen zu tun: Optimieren Sie Ihre Datenbank (Spam, Post-Korrekturen, Entwürfe, Tabellen usw.), um deren Overhead zu verringern.
Deaktivieren Sie Hotlinking und Leeching Ihrer Inhalte
Hotlinking ist eine Art der Datenübertragung „Raub“. Es passiert, wenn verschiedene Zielführer eine Verbindung zu den Bildern auf Ihrer Website aus ihren Artikeln herstellen, wodurch Ihr Server-Stack immer höher wird.
Dies kann dazu führen, dass immer mehr Personen Ihre Beiträge „reiben“ oder Ihre Site (und insbesondere Bilder) bekannter werden, wie es für den Fall erforderlich ist, dass Sie ständig benutzerdefinierte Bilder für Ihre Site erstellen.
Hinzufügen eines Expirs-Headers zu statischen Ressourcen
Ein Expires-Header ist ein Ansatz, einen Zeitraum ausreichend weit später anzugeben, mit dem Ziel, dass die Kunden (Programme) keine statische Substanz (zB CSS-Dokument, Javascript, Bilder usw.) erneut abrufen müssen.
Auf diese Weise können Sie Ihre Heap-Zeit für Ihre üblichen Clients erheblich verkürzen.
Gravatar-Bilder anpassen
Sie werden auf dieser Site sehen, dass das Standardbild von Gravatar auf ... naja, nichts eingestellt ist.
Dies ist keine stilvolle Entscheidung, ich habe sie getroffen, da sie die Seitenstapel verbessert, indem sie im Wesentlichen nichts hat, wo regelmäßig ein albern aussehendes Gravatar-Logo oder irgendein anderer Quatsch wäre.
Einige Websites gehen so weit, dass sie alle auf der Webseite und für alle behindert werden.
LazyLoad zu deinen Bildern hinzufügen
LazyLoad ist der Weg, um nur die Bilder über dem Overlay-Stack zu haben (dh nur die Bilder, die im Programmfenster des Gastes sichtbar sind), an diesem Punkt, wenn der Benutzer nach unten schaut, beginnen alternative Bilder zu stapeln, kurz bevor sie zu sehen sind.
Dies beschleunigt nicht nur das Laden von Seiten, sondern kann auch die Übertragungsgeschwindigkeit verringern, indem weniger Informationen für Kunden gestapelt werden, die nicht über die Entfernung auf Ihren Seiten nach unten schauen.
Kontrollieren Sie die Anzahl der gespeicherten Beitragsrevisionen
Ich nutze das Modul Revision Control, um sicherzustellen, dass ich aktuelle Updates auf einer Basis halte, setze es auf 2 oder 3, damit Sie im Falle eines Fehlers auf etwas zurückgreifen können, jedoch nicht sehr hoch, dass Sie Ihr Backend mit Überflüssigem durcheinander bringen Maßnahmen der ausgeschriebenen Stellen.
Pingbacks und Trackbacks deaktivieren
Natürlich verbindet sich WordPress mit verschiedenen Webjournalen, die mit Pingbacks und Trackbacks ausgestattet sind.
Jedes Mal, wenn ein anderer Blog Sie bemerkt, weist er Ihre Website darauf hin, wodurch die Informationen zum Beitrag aktualisiert werden. Wenn Sie dies deaktivieren, werden die Backlinks zu Ihrer Site nicht zerstört, sondern nur die Einstellung, die Ihrer Site ein beträchtliches Maß an Arbeit abverlangt.
Ersetzen Sie PHP bei Bedarf durch statisches HTML
Dieser ist ein winziger Fortschritt, kann jedoch Ihre Heap-Zeit definitiv verkürzen, wenn Sie nervös sind, Seitenstapelgeschwindigkeiten zu integrieren, also habe ich ihn aufgenommen.
Verwenden Sie CloudFlare
Dies ist wie der obige Bereich über die Verwendung von CDNs, jedoch habe ich mich als so verbunden mit CloudFlare herausgestellt, seit ich in meinem besten Web-Prüfungsgeschenk darüber gesprochen habe, dass ich mich entschieden habe, es hier unabhängig zu integrieren.
Um es stumpf auszudrücken, CloudFlare ist neben dem oben erwähnten W3-Total-Cache-Modul eine wirklich starke Mischung (sie integrieren sich ineinander), die die Geschwindigkeit sowie die Sicherheit Ihrer Site unglaublich verbessern wird.